What Is a Rollator with Seat?
A rollator with seat is a My Mobility Scooters gadget created to help individuals with walking while providing a location to rest. Unlike traditional walkers, rollators typically come equipped with four wheels, hand brakes, and a built-in seat. This combination permits users to preserve mobility while also ensuring they can take breaks whenever necessary.

When exploring the options offered, people must think about factors such as:
Size and Weight Capacity: Ensure the rollator can comfortably support the user's weight.Adjustability: Look for alternatives with adjustable handle heights.Wheels: Larger wheels offer better navigation over rough surface, while smaller wheels may be ideal for smooth surface areas.Storage Features: Evaluate the need for storage abilities like baskets or trays.Upkeep and Care
Appropriate upkeep of a rollator can boost its lifespan and use. Here are some important pointers for care:

Q2: Can I use my rollator outdoors?
A2: Yes, rollators are designed for both indoor and outdoor use; however, some models are much better fit for rough terrains than others.

Q4: How much do rollators with seats cost?
A4: Prices vary considerably depending on the brand and features, with standard models beginning around ₤ 100 and more advanced types costing as much as ₤ 500 or more.
Q5: Are rollators safe?
A5: Yes, rollators are typically safe when utilized correctly. Users should familiarize themselves with how to operate the brakes and adjust the rollator to prevent mishaps.
